HomeMy WebLinkAboutZ-7407-A Staff AnalysisOctober 27, 2003 ITEM NO.: 2.1 File No.: Z -7407-A Owner: Jalal Masoud Address: 9203 Chicot Road Description, Southeast corner of Chicot Road and Preston Drive Zoned: C-3 Variance Requested: A variance is requested from the sign provisions of Section 36-555 to allow incidental signage which exceeds the maximum area allowed. Justification: The applicant's justification is presented in an attached letter. Present Use of Property: Convenience Store Proposed Use of Property: Convenience Store STAFF REPORT A. Public Works Issues: No Comments. B. Staff Analysis: The C-3 zoned property at 9203 Chicot Road is occupied by a one-story convenience store building. The property is located at the southeast corner of Chicot Road and Preston Drive. There are existing driveways from Chicot Road and Preston Drive which serve as access. The Board of Adjustment recently approved variances associated with a building addition on the east end of the existing building. There is one (1) wall sign ("Fast Mart") on the front (west side) of the building which has a sign permit. This sign utilizes 32 square feet of an allowable 76 square feet of signage for this side of the building. In addition, there is approximately 114 square feet of incidental signage on October 27, 2003 ITEM NO.: the front of the building. This includes the neon beer signs located on the inside of the front windows. There are no signs on the Preston Drive side of the building. Section 36-555(a)(2)d. of the City's Zoning Ordinance allows a maximum of 20 square feet of incidental signage per commercial occupancy. Therefore, the applicant is requesting a variance from this ordinance standard, to allow the additional incidental signage. Staff is supportive of the requested variance. Staff feels that the applicant should permit the changeable copy sign above the doors and windows on front of the building as a permanent wall sign. This would leave approximately 76 square feet of incidental signage. Staff feels that this amount of incidental signage is reasonable as long as no signage is placed on the north (Preston Drive) side of the building. The ordinance would typically allow 48 square feet of signage (before building addition) on the Preston Drive side of the building. Staff feels that the amount of existing signage on the front of the building will have no adverse impact on the general area. C. Staff Recommendations: Staff recommends approval of the requested sign variance, subject to the following conditions: 1. The changeable copy sign over the doors and windows on front of the building must be permitted as a wall sign. 2. A maximum of 76 square feet of incidental signage will be allowed on the front (west side) of the building. 3. No signage will be allowed on the Preston Drive side of the building. BOARD OF ADJUSTMENT: (OCTOBER 27, 2003) The applicant was present. There were no objectors present. Staff presented the item and a recommendation of approval. The applicant offered no additional comments. The item was placed on the Consent Agenda and approved as recommended by staff by a vote of 5 ayes and 0 nays. r7
